-FRANKFURT, Oct 13 (Reuters) - A surcharge levied on German consumers to support renewable power will be reduced by around 1.2 percent next year, industry sources said on Friday. 
  
-The surcharge under the renewable energy act (EEG) would amount to close to 6.8 euro cents (8. -The country's four network operators (TSOs), which collect the fee, are due to deliver a statement on the widely watched instrument early on Monday. 
- 
-It comprised just over a fifth of consumers' final bills in 2016 and therefore represents the biggest and most symbolic spending block for Germany's Energiewende policy to transition to renewables.
